    It is the official journal of the European Society of Intensive Care Medicine. The editor-in-chief is Giuseppe Citerio (University of Milano Bicocca). It is published by Springer Science+Business Media. "Intensive Care Medicine" is the publication platform for communicating and exchanging current work and ideas in intensive care medicine.

    The ELSO registry has been instrumental in improving ECMO care, post-cardiac arrest management, pediatric ventricular assist devices, and organ transplantation. [ 9 ] The last formally published ELSO Registry report was in 2017, and contained clinical characteristics, complications, and outcomes of 78,397 patients supported with ECMO. [ 10 ]

    The European Medical Students' Association (EMSA) is a non-governmental and non-profit organisation for medical students; [1] it offers opportunities to their members and provides a voice for medical students across Europe, representing their interests to other European institutions and organizations. EMSA was founded in Brussels in 1990.
